public class HttpResponder {
private static final boolean CORS_ENABLED = Configuration.getInstance().getBooleanProperty(CoreConfig.CORS_ENABLED);
private static final String CORS_ALLOWED_ORIGINS = Configuration.getInstance().getStringProperty(CoreConfig.CORS_ALLOWED_ORIGINS);
private static final String KEEP_ALIVE_TIMEOUT_STR = "timeout=";
private static final Logger log = LoggerFactory.getLogger(HttpResponder.class);
private static HttpResponder INSTANCE = new HttpResponder();
public static HttpResponder getInstance() { return INSTANCE; }
private int httpConnIdleTimeout =
Configuration.getInstance().getIntegerProperty(HttpConfig.HTTP_CONNECTION_READ_IDLE_TIME_SECONDS);
@VisibleForTesting
HttpResponder() {}
@VisibleForTesting
HttpResponder(int httpConnIdleTimeout) {
this.httpConnIdleTimeout = httpConnIdleTimeout;
}
public void respond(ChannelHandlerContext ctx, FullHttpRequest req, HttpResponseStatus status) {
respond(ctx, req, new DefaultFullHttpResponse(HTTP_1_1, status));
}
public void respond(ChannelHandlerContext ctx, FullHttpRequest req, FullHttpResponse res) {
// set response headers
if (CORS_ENABLED) {
res.headers().add("Access-Control-Allow-Origin", CORS_ALLOWED_ORIGINS);
}
if (res.content() != null) {
setContentLength(res, res.content().readableBytes());
}
boolean isKeepAlive = isKeepAlive(req);
if (isKeepAlive) {
res.headers().add(CONNECTION, KEEP_ALIVE);
// if this config is set to non zero, it means we intend
// to close this connection after x seconds. We need to
// respond back with the right headers to indicate this
if ( httpConnIdleTimeout > 0 ) {
res.headers().add(KEEP_ALIVE, KEEP_ALIVE_TIMEOUT_STR + httpConnIdleTimeout);
}
}
// Send the response and close the connection if necessary.
ctx.channel().write(res);
if (req == null || !isKeepAlive) {
log.debug("Closing channel. isKeepAlive:" + isKeepAlive + " on channel: " + ctx.channel().toString());
ctx.writeAndFlush(Unpooled.EMPTY_BUFFER).addListener(ChannelFutureListener.CLOSE);
}
}
}
